Home
Login
Upload Video
Menu
May 10, 2025
Mexicans Tearing It Down At The Fiesta
November 28, 2023
January 31, 2025
December 27, 2024
August 21, 2024
3hours ago
5hours ago
12hours ago
New Here? Sign up now